Sector Update: Financial
Dec 2, 2024 10:39 AM

01:22 PM EST, 12/02/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Financial stocks were decreasing in Monday afternoon trading, with the NYSE Financial Index down 0.7% and the Financial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LF) off 0.8%.

The Philadelphia Housing Index was easing 0.1%, and the Real Estate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LRE) was falling 1.5%.

Bitcoin (BTC-USD) was declining 2% to $95,348, and the yield for 10-year US Treasuries was rising 1 basis point to 4.19%.

In economic news, the Institute for Supply Management's US manufacturing index increased to 48.4 in November from 46.5 in the previous month, above the expected 47.6 reading in a survey compiled by Bloomberg.

US construction spending rose by 0.4% in October, compared with a 0.2% increase expected in a survey compiled by Bloomberg.

In corporate news, Citigroup ( C ) has completed the separation of its institutional banking operations in Mexico from its consumer, small and middle-market businesses, Bloomberg reported. Citi shares added 0.8%.
